Bishops Urge Catholics to Support Immigrants

U.S. Roman Catholic bishops started a nationwide campaign urging their faithful to support legislation to aid immigrants, including measures to provide legal status to undocumented workers.

“Our immigration system is broken and needs repair,” said Cardinal Theodore McCarrick, the leader of the Washington archdiocese, at a news conference announcing the effort.

Officials said that as part of the campaign, Catholic churches would be provided with outlines of sermons to be given on immigration. Speakers will also address Catholic lay groups on the subject, officials said.
